Not all Vets immunize against Kennel Cough, because if a dog isn't going to a kennel, or isn't running in dog parks etc...they aren't likely to catch it. Call you Vet and find out if he immunized them for Kennel Cough...And these days, Kennel Cough immunization is given thru the nostril...

It's a VERY catchy disease.
